Several delegations call on Vice-chairperson DDC Udhampur
FacebookTwitterWhatsappTelegram

UDHAMPUR, SEPTEMBER 08: Numerous delegations today called on Juhi Manhas Pathania, Vice Chairperson District Development Council here at her office in DC office complex, Udhampur.

A variety of issues were projected including provision of drinking water, electricity supply, road connectivity, paucity of staff in schools of various far flung areas of District Udhampur.

A deputation called upon the Vice Chairperson regarding the clearance of land requisitioning under RAIP Act-1952 and land acquired under the land acquisition act by Army Authorities.

While interacting with the deputation and talking to the civil secretariat as well as the defence authorities, she called for immediate clearance of the same without any further delay.

A spirited deputation from Ritti called upon the Vice – Chairperson for sanctioning funds under NABARD for the road from Ritti to Kothi in 3rd to km 4th.

Jattu Ram, DDC Ramnagar II also projected various developmental issues pertaining to the area represented by him. He called for prevailing upon ERA for extending Pattri to Beri road upto Panchayat Ghar Bhatyari. The said road will provide an alternate road network connecting the said road to Kagote Dalsar road and will provide connectivity to Ramnagar.

A deputation from the Tikri area put forth the demand for construction of a bridge over Raal Nallah from Khandui to Pagyal. Another deputation from Sattian Pan hayat of Ramnagar area demanded for construction of Protection work for prevention of loss of public land from landslides.

Another deputation from Khoon area called for addressing paucity of staff and lack of proper infrastructure in the various schools of the area. Most of the high secondary and high schools in the areas are without any lecturers.

After giving a patient hearing to all the deputations, the Vice Chairperson took up these issues with the concerned departments and instructed them to provide viable solutions to the people.

Various other delegations led by PRI members had detailed discussions with the Vice Chairperson regarding key developmental issues pertaining to their areas regarding shortage of drinking water, irregular water supply, electricity supply, paucity of Staff in schools and health institutions.

She assured delegations of proper redressal of all their demands.
